Hubs FinOps
Os hubs FinOps são uma plataforma confiável para análise de custos, insights e otimização – centros de comando virtuais para líderes de toda a organização relatarem, monitorarem e otimizarem custos com base em suas necessidades organizacionais. Os hubs FinOps concentram-se em três princípios fundamentais de design:
-
Seja o padrão
Esforce-se para ser a principal personificação do FinOps Framework. -
Construído para escala
Projetado para suportar as maiores contas e organizações. -
Aberto e extensível
Abrace o ecossistema e priorize a habilitação da plataforma.
Os hubs FinOps estendem o Gerenciamento de Custos para fornecer uma plataforma escalável para relatórios e análises de dados avançados, por meio de ferramentas como Power BI e Microsoft Fabric. Os hubs FinOps são uma base para construir sua própria solução de gerenciamento e otimização de custos.
Nota
Custo estimado: Começa em $120/mês + $10/mês por cada $1M no custo monitorizado.
O custo mensal estimado inclui US$ 120 para um cluster de nó único do Azure Data Explorer, além de US$ 10 em custos de armazenamento e processamento do Azure por cada US$ 1 milhão monitorado. O custo exato variará com base nos descontos, no tamanho dos dados (estimamos ~20 GB por US$ 1 milhão) e nos requisitos de licença do Power BI. O custo sem o Data Explorer é de US$ 5 por US$ 1 milhão. Para obter detalhes, consulte a de estimativa de custo do hub
Nota
Os hubs FinOps exigem uma conta Enterprise Agreement (EA), Microsoft Customer Agreement (MCA) ou Microsoft Partner Agreement (MPA) (incluindo assinaturas do Cloud Solution Provider). Se você tiver um Contrato do Microsoft Online Services (MOSA, geralmente chamado de pagamento conforme o uso) ou uma assinatura interna da Microsoft, precisará usar hubs FinOps 0.1.1. Os relatórios do Power BI não foram testados extensivamente com assinaturas MOSA e MS Internas. Fale com um representante da Microsoft ou apresente um pedido de suporte de faturação para saber mais sobre a migração da sua subscrição para o Contrato de Cliente Microsoft.
Porquê hubs FinOps?
Muitas organizações que usam o Microsoft Cost Management acabam batendo em uma parede onde precisam de algum recurso que não está disponível nativamente. Quando o fazem, as suas únicas opções são usar uma das muitas ferramentas de terceiros ou construir algo a partir do zero. Embora o ecossistema de ferramentas de gerenciamento de custos seja rico e vasto, com muitas ótimas opções, elas podem ser exageradas ou talvez não resolvam necessidades específicas. Nesses casos, as organizações exportam dados de custos e criam uma solução personalizada. Mas isso traz muitos desafios, já que essas organizações não contam com os engenheiros de dados necessários para projetar, criar e manter uma plataforma de dados escalável. Os hubs FinOps procuram fornecer essa base para agilizar os esforços para começar a operar com sua própria solução de gerenciamento de custos interno.
Os hubs FinOps agilizam a implementação do FinOps Framework. Eles estão sendo projetados para serem dimensionados para atender às maiores necessidades da empresa. Além disso, eles são abertos e extensíveis para dar suporte à criação de soluções personalizadas sem o incômodo de criar o armazenamento de dados de back-end. Os hubs FinOps são projetados para e pela comunidade. Junte-se à discussão e diga-nos o que gostaria de ver a seguir ou saiba como contribuir e fazer parte da equipa.
Participe do debateSaiba como contribuir
Benefícios
Os hubs FinOps oferecem muitos benefícios em relação ao uso de exportações de Gerenciamento de Custos.
- Crie relatórios sobre o custo e o uso em várias contas e assinaturas em locatários separados.
- Execute consultas analíticas avançadas e crie relatórios sobre as tendências de custos ano a ano em segundos.
- Relatório sobre economias de desconto negociadas e de compromisso para contas de faturamento EA e perfis de faturamento MCA.
- Alinhamento total com o FinOps Open Cost and Usage Specification (FOCUS).
- Limpe dados duplicados nas exportações diárias do Cost Management (e economize dinheiro em armazenamento).
- Converta dados exportados em parquet para um acesso mais rápido aos dados.
- Extensível por meio de recursos padrão do Data Factory e do Power BI para integrar dados de custos de negócios ou de outros provedores.
- Conecte o Power BI ao Azure Government e ao Azure China¹.
- Conecte o Power BI às assinaturas do Microsoft Online Services Agreement (MOSA)¹.
¹ As subscrições Azure Government, Azure China e MOSA (ou pay-as-you-go) só são suportadas nos hubs FinOps 0.1.1. Os hubs FinOps 0.2+ requerem dados de custo FOCUS das exportações do Cost Management, que não são suportados para assinaturas MOSA. Entre em contato com o suporte sobre a transição para uma conta do Contrato de Cliente da Microsoft.
O que está incluído
O modelo de hub FinOps inclui os seguintes recursos:
- Azure Data Explorer (Kusto) como um armazenamento de dados escalável para análise avançada (opcional).
- Conta de armazenamento (Data Lake Storage Gen2) como uma área de preparo para ingestão de dados.
- Instância do Data Factory para gerenciar a ingestão e a limpeza de dados.
- Cofre de chaves para armazenar as credenciais de identidade gerenciadas pelo sistema Data Factory.
Depois de implantado, você pode gerar relatórios sobre os dados diretamente usando consultas do Data Explorer, painéis do Data Explorer, Power BI ou conectando-se diretamente ao banco de dados ou à conta de armazenamento.
Nota
Este artigo contém imagens que mostram dados de exemplo. Quaisquer dados de preços são apenas para fins de teste.
Eis alguns exemplos de relatórios:
Procurar relatóriosVer o modelo
Explore os relatórios FinOps
Cada relatório no kit de ferramentas FinOps está disponível como um arquivo PBIX ou PBIT. O arquivo PBIX contém dados de exemplo que podem ser exibidos no Power BI desktop sem se conectar à sua conta.
Para visualizar os relatórios disponíveis, baixe o arquivo de relatório do PBIX Power BI da versão desejada e abra o relatório no Power BI Desktop. A partir daí, você pode navegar pelas diferentes páginas do relatório, que são pré-preenchidas com dados de teste.
Criar um novo hub
Para criar um novo hub FinOps, siga estas etapas:
Implante seu hub FinOps.
Configure escopos para monitorar.
Os hubs FinOps usam exportações do Gerenciamento de Custos para carregar os dados que você deseja monitorar. Você pode configurar as exportações manualmente ou conceder acesso ao seu hub para gerenciar as exportações para você.
Para obter mais informações, consulte Configurar escopos.
Conecte-se aos seus dados.
Pode ligar aos seus dados a partir de qualquer sistema que suporte o Azure Data Explorer ou o armazenamento do Azure. Para obter ideias, consulte Introdução aos hubs. Recomendamos o uso de modelos iniciais pré-criados do Power BI para começar rapidamente.
Para obter mais informações, consulte Conectar-se aos seus dados.
Se tiver algum problema, consulte Resolução de problemas de relatórios do Power BI.
Nota
Se você precisar implantar no Azure Gov ou no Azure China, use os hubs FinOps 0.1.1. As instruções são as mesmas, exceto que você criará uma exportação de custo amortizado em vez de uma exportação FOCUS.
Se tiver algum problema, consulte o Guia de solução de problemas.
Um escopo é uma construção do Azure que contém recursos ou habilita a compra de serviços, como um grupo de recursos, assinatura, grupo de gerenciamento ou conta de cobrança. A ID de recurso para um escopo é o URI do Azure Resource Manager que identifica o escopo (por exemplo, "/subscriptions/###" para uma assinatura ou "/providers/Microsoft.Billing/billingAccounts/###" para uma conta de cobrança). Para obter mais informações, veja Compreender e trabalhar com âmbitos.
Introdução aos hubs
Depois de implantar uma instância de hub, há várias maneiras de começar:
Personalize os relatórios pré-criados do Power BI.
Nossos relatórios do Power BI são modelos iniciais e destinam-se a ser personalizados. Nós encorajamos você a personalizar conforme necessário. Mais informações.
Crie seus próprios relatórios do Power BI.
Se quiser criar seus próprios relatórios ou adicionar dados de custo a um relatório existente, você pode copiar consultas de um relatório pré-criado. Ou você pode se conectar manualmente usando o conector do Azure Data Lake Storage Gen2.
Conecte-se ao Microsoft Fabric para consultas avançadas.
Se você usar o OneLake no Microsoft Fabric, poderá criar um atalho para o
ingestion
contêiner em sua conta de armazenamento de hubs para executar consultas SQL ou KQL diretamente nos dados em hubs. Mais informações.Aceda aos dados de custos a partir de ferramentas personalizadas.
Os dados são armazenados em
do Azure Data Explorer e em uma conta Azure Data Lake Storage Gen2. Você pode usar qualquer ferramenta que ofereça suporte ao Azure Data Lake Storage Gen2 para acessar os dados. Consulte o dicionário de dados para obter detalhes sobre as colunas disponíveis. Aplique a lógica de alocação de custos, aumente ou manipule seus dados de custo usando o Data Factory.
O Data Factory é usado para ingerir e transformar dados. Recomendamos o uso do Data Factory como uma solução econômica para aplicar lógica personalizada aos seus dados de custo. Não modifique pipelines internos ou dados no contêiner msexports . Se você criar pipelines personalizados, monitore novos dados no contêiner de ingestão e use um prefixo consistente para garantir que eles não se sobreponham a novos pipelines. Consulte o processamento de dados para obter detalhes sobre como os dados são processados.
Importante
Tenha em mente que esta é a principal área que estamos planejando evoluir nos próximos lançamentos do kit de ferramentas FinOps. Familiarize-se com o roteiro para evitar conflitos com atualizações futuras. Considere contribuir para o projeto para adicionar suporte para novos cenários para evitar conflitos.
Gere alertas personalizados usando o Power Automate.
Você tem muitas opções para gerar alertas personalizados. O Power Automate é uma ótima opção para pessoas que são novas na automação. Você também pode usar o Data Factory, o Functions ou qualquer outro serviço que ofereça suporte a código personalizado ou acesso direto a dados no Azure Data Lake Storage Gen2.
Não importa o que você escolha fazer, recomendamos a criação de um novo módulo Bicep para dar suporte à atualização de sua solução. Você pode fazer referência finops-hub/main.bicep
ou hub.bicep
diretamente para garantir que possa aplicar novas atualizações à medida que elas são lançadas.
Se você precisar alterar hub.bicep
, certifique-se de controlar essas alterações e reaplicá-las ao atualizar para a versão mais recente. Geralmente, não recomendamos modificar o modelo ou os módulos diretamente para evitar conflitos com atualizações futuras. Em vez disso, considere contribuir com essas alterações de volta para o projeto de código aberto.
Mais informações.
Se você acessar dados no armazenamento ou estiver criando ou personalizando relatórios do Power BI, consulte o dicionário de dados para obter detalhes sobre as colunas disponíveis.
Permissões obrigatórias
As permissões necessárias para implantar ou atualizar instâncias de hub são abordadas nos detalhes do modelo.
Você precisa de uma ou mais das seguintes opções para exportar seus dados de custo:
Âmbito | Permissão |
---|---|
Subscrições e grupos de recursos (todos os tipos de conta) | Contribuidor do Cost Management: |
Escopos de faturamento do EA | Enterprise Reader, Department Reader ou Account Owner (também conhecido como conta de inscrição). |
Escopos de faturamento MCA | Colaborador na conta de faturação, perfil de faturação ou secção de fatura. |
Escopos de faturamento MPA | Colaborador na conta de faturação, perfil de faturação ou cliente. |
Os clientes CSP precisam configurar exportações para cada assinatura para ingerir seu custo total em hubs FinOps. O Gerenciamento de Custos não oferece suporte a exportações de grupos de gerenciamento para assinaturas MCA ou CSP (a partir de maio de 2024).
Para obter informações, consulte a documentação do Gerenciamento de custos.
Conteúdos relacionados
Recursos de FinOps relacionados:
Produtos relacionados:
Soluções relacionadas:
- Relatórios do Power BI do kit de ferramentas FinOps
- Pastas de trabalho FinOps
- Dados abertos do kit de ferramentas FinOps